Raising And Poker

If you have two pairs or better and think you have the best hand then you should raise. This will get more money in the pot and hopefully narrow the field for you. If you only have top pair and a player bets into you, that usually means he is not afraid of top pair. You should not raise in this situation. It is better to just call and see what the river card brings.

Scare Cards
Any time the board pairs, or there is a third suited card on the turn, you need to re-evaluate your hand. If you held the best hand after the flop, it is possible that it got demoted with the turn card. If you made a straight on the flop but the turn brings a third suited card, you could be up against a flush. If you bet this hand and are raised you can be pretty sure that is the case. If the board pairs and there is action you might be looking at a full house. If there is a bet and raise before it is your turn to act, you will be able to get out of this hand cheaply. You may hate having to fold a straight, but it will be a lot more expensive to call the river with a hand that was beaten on the turn.

Make Your Choice
Most of the time when you call a bet or raise on the turn, you are committing yourself to betting on the river as well. With only one card to come it should be apparent how your hand stacks up against the board. Since the betting limits are double, a mistake on the turn will cost you more than one on the flop. Don't play wish hands or hands that you are drawing dead to. A winning player knows how to release a marginal hand and the turn is definitely the time to do it.

If you have been playing properly, you will not see the river card unless you have a strong hand that is a favorite to win or you have a draw to a winning hand. Once the river card is turned over you know exactly what you have. If you were drawing to a hand, you know whether you were successful or not. By reading the board, you can determine the strength of your hand and know how it compares to the nuts.

Calling In Poker

Most of the time you will call a bet in front of you if you were planning to bet it anyway. This doesn't mean, however, that you will automatically call a raise. First you must consider who made the raise and what position that player is in. If a player raises on the turn from early position it usually means he has a strong hand. You should not call a raise with just one pair on the turn if there are many players in the hand. If the raise was made from late position, it could be a semi-bluff, but calling a raise with only a pair can be costly. If you have a drawing hand you should be certain you are drawing to the nuts, or close to it, if you are calling a raise.

Here is a money saving tip. Don't call a bet on the turn with just two overcards. In the long run you will lose more than you will win, even if you pair one of your cards on the river. If there are several players in the hand, you are probably drawing dead trying to make a high pair. Drawing dead means you are drawing to a hand that you can't win even if you make it.
